A fun thing to do is start with walking trips to prepare yourself for the miles you'll be logging at WDW as you see the theme parks. We started working on our walking plan several months before our trip to WDW. Walking is a great and convenient exercise and you'll be motivated, thinking about your upcoming trip. Another trick I do is to eat a more substantial meal at lunch and have a light meal at dinner time like a salad with protein.
